The search for a WorkNC post processor download typically begins when a shop acquires a new machine or retrofits an existing one. The primary and most reliable source for these files is Hexagon’s official customer portal. Because post processors are sensitive files that dictate machine behavior, obtaining them directly from the software developer or authorized resellers is the safest route. Official posts are typically tested against a library of known machine kinematics. However, the term "download" can be misleading; often, a user does not simply download a static file. Instead, they utilize a post processor generator or a library integrated into the WorkNC interface. In many cases, users download a "base" post—a generic template for a specific controller like Fanuc 18i—and then customize it to their specific machine configuration. Furthermore, the management of post processors is a critical aspect of Industry 4.0 and digital continuity. Once a post processor is downloaded and fine-tuned—perhaps to account for a specific fixture offset or a non-standard tool length probe routine—it becomes a proprietary asset of the manufacturing shop. Relying on a generic "download" link for future updates can overwrite these customizations. Therefore, best practices dictate that manufacturers maintain a secure, backed-up library of their verified post processors. This ensures that if a programmer leaves the company or a computer crashes, the translation logic required to run the shop’s expensive machinery is not lost.

In the intricate world of Computer-Aided Manufacturing (CAM), the software interface is only as good as its ability to communicate with the hardware. For users of Vero WorkNC, a premier CAM solution known for its automation and reliability, the "post processor" is the critical bridge between a digital toolpath and a physical machined part. While the software creates the geometry and calculates the movements, the post processor translates these calculations into the specific language—G-code—that a particular CNC machine controller understands. The process of finding, downloading, and implementing the correct post processor is not merely a technical formality; it is a fundamental determinant of manufacturing efficiency, safety, and precision.

To understand the importance of the post processor download, one must first understand its function. A CNC machine does not inherently understand the high-level commands generated by WorkNC, such as "rough pocket" or "adaptive trochoidal mill." It understands axis movements (G0, G1), tool changes (M6), and spindle speeds (S). However, the syntax for these commands varies wildly between controller manufacturers. A Fanuc controller requires a different syntax than a Siemens or Heidenhain controller; a 3-axis mill requires different logic than a simultaneous 5-axis machine. The post processor acts as a translator, formatting the CLSF (Cutter Location Source File) into a text file tailored to the machine’s specific dialect. Without the correct post processor, the code is gibberish to the machine, leading to crashes, scrapped parts, or a machine that simply refuses to run.

The alternative to official channels is the "wild west" of manufacturing forums and third-party repositories. While user groups and CAD/CAM forums often share post processor files, downloading them from these unverified sources carries significant risk. A post processor downloaded from a forum might contain errors in the formatting of coolant commands, tool change sequences, or coordinate system rotations. In a 5-axis environment, an incorrect post can cause the machine head to collide with the table or the workpiece, resulting in tens of thousands of dollars in damage. Therefore, the act of downloading a post processor must be accompanied by a rigorous verification process. Users are encouraged to run the downloaded code through simulation software like NCSIMUL or Machine Simulation within WorkNC before ever running it on actual hardware.
